FG Brings Relief to Workers As Payment of N35,000 Wage Award Arrears Begins Soon – AGF

In a bring relief to its workforce, the Federal Government says it will soon begin the payment of the N35,000 wage award arrears.

The Office of the Accountant General of the Federation (OAGF) disclosed this on Monday.

According to a statement by Bawa Mokwa, the spokesman for the Office, the office had received receipt of funds for the settlement of the arrears.

He denied that the Accountant General of the Federation, Mr. Babatunde Ogunjimi, ever said the N35,000 wage award was excluded from the federal budget of N54.99 trillion for 2025.

“The office said the Accountant General of the Federation didn’t brief the press on the wage award and has assured that the outstanding arrears would be paid as promised by the government,” the statement said.

It said the disbursement would be done in installments of N35,000 for five months.
